Abstract:

Web search engine based on DNS, the standard proposed solution of IETF for public web search system, is introduced in this paper. Now no web search engine can cover more than 60 percent of all the pages on Internet. The update interval of most pages database is almost one month. This condition hasn't changed for many years. Converge and recency problems have become the bottleneck problem of current web search engine. To solve these problems, a new system, search engine based on DNS is proposed in this paper. This system adopts the hierarchical distributed architecture like DNS, which is different from any current commercial search engine. In theory, this system can cover all the web pages on Internet. Its update interval could even be one day. The original idea, detailed content and implementation of this system all are introduced in this paper.
